Output d34e136ef29248ad2009ba14d1557696c1f07a3cab7b0976678859388a212288:0
- value
- 3334306
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c59c32cba736dc213af7452a65242405f14b7e2b OP_EQUAL
- address
- 3KhtAC2DAy2X8UKSPUVVpmR5aurKPPDgkC
- transaction
- d34e136ef29248ad2009ba14d1557696c1f07a3cab7b0976678859388a212288
- confirmations
- 258667
- spent
- true